Transaction 41b785fee11206ea03ec60262b42c4854163088724b8c522026ccdebd3311456
1 Input
1 Output
-
41b785fee11206ea03ec60262b42c4854163088724b8c522026ccdebd3311456:0
- value
- 17811462
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 24be6a2a5877a44ca181d61893feee8d4b235528 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14MHS9odhw6LQBGTksddcxBYHRhJ5ChQqB